Travel from Shaheed Nagar to Netaji Subhash Place on a direct Delhi Metro service with no interchange required. The journey covers 17 stations over approximately 19.23 km. A token fare is ₹43, while smart card users pay ₹39. Trains run from 06:17 AM to 11:13 PM, about every 5–7 minutes.

Shaheed Nagar to Netaji Subhash Place runs on the Red Line of Delhi Metro. The journey takes about 41 minutes across 17 stations.
No interchanges on this route. Trains run daily from 06:17 AM to 11:13 PM, every 5–7 minutes.
Token fare: ₹43 · Smart Card fare: ₹39.
Shaheed Nagar, Dilshad Garden, Jhilmil, Mansarovar Park, Shahdara, Welcome, Seelampur, Shastri Park, Kashmere Gate, Tis Hazari, Pulbangash, Pratap Nagar, Shastri Nagar, Inderlok, Kanhaiya Nagar, Keshav Puram, Netaji Subhash Place
